| Grant Comments | Output Power is EIRP and ERP for above and below 1 GHz, respectively, except for Part 90 LTE Band 26 emissions, which are conducted. SAR compliance for body-worn operating configurations is limited to belt-clips and holsters that have no metallic components in the assembly and cause the device to operate with the minimum separation distance of 1.5 cm, as described in this filing. End-users must be informed of the body-worn operating requirements for satisfying RF exposure compliance. The highest reported SAR for head, body-worn accessory, product specific (wireless router) and simultaneous transmission exposure conditions are 0.46 W/kg, 0.48 W/kg, 0.73 W/kg and 1.24 W/kg, respectively. This device supports LTE of 1.4, 3, 5, 10, 15 and 20 MHz bandwidth modes for FDD LTE Bands 2, 4, 25 and 66; LTE of 5, 10, 15 and 20 MHz bandwidth modes for FDD LTE Bands 7 and 71; LTE of 1.4, 3, 5 and 10 MHz bandwidth modes for FDD LTE Bands 5 and 12; LTE of 5 and 10 MHz bandwidth modes for FDD LTE Bands 13 and 17; LTE of 1.4, 3, 5, 10 and 15 MHz bandwidth modes for FDD LTE Band 26; and LTE of 5, 10, 15 and 20 MHz bandwidth modes for TDD LTE Bands 38 and 41. This device also supports Frequency Range 1 5G NR modes of 5, 10, 15, and 20 MHz bandwidth for FDD Bands n2, n5, n25, n66 and n71; 10, 15, 20, 30, 40, 60, 80, 90 and 100 MHz bandwidth modes for TDD Band n41; and 10, 15, 20, 40, 50, 60, 80, 90 and 100 MHz bandwidth modes for TDD Band n77. Certification of 3GPP 5G NR band n77 operations is limited to the 3.45 GHz segment under Part 27.5(o) and the 3.7 GHz segment under Part 27.5(m). Frequency Range 1 5G NR ENDC modes are supported by this device, as described in this filing. |
